#!/usr/bin/python
# -*- coding: utf-8 -*-
"""Citations model for tracking journal articles."""
from peewee import IntegerField, TextField, CharField, ForeignKeyField
from .journals import Journals
from ..rest.orm import CherryPyAPI
from .utils import unicode_type
# Citations has too many attributes...
# pylint: disable=too-many-instance-attributes
[docs]class Citations(CherryPyAPI):
"""
Citations model tracks metadata for a journal article.
Attributes:
+--------------------------+-----------------------------------------+
| Name | Description |
+==========================+=========================================+
| article_title | The title of the article |
+--------------------------+-----------------------------------------+
| journal | Link to the journal it was published in |
+--------------------------+-----------------------------------------+
| journal_volume | Journal volume for the publication |
+--------------------------+-----------------------------------------+
| journal_issue | Journal issue for the publication |
+--------------------------+-----------------------------------------+
| page_range | Pages in issue/volume was the article |
+--------------------------+-----------------------------------------+
| abstract_text | Abstract from the article in the |
| | journal |
+--------------------------+-----------------------------------------+
| xml_text | xml blob for the citation |
+--------------------------+-----------------------------------------+
| release_authorization_id | External link to authorization metadata |
| | about the released article |
+--------------------------+-----------------------------------------+
| doi_reference | Digital Object Identifier for the |
| | citation |
+--------------------------+-----------------------------------------+
| encoding | Language this metadata is in not the |
| | article itself |
+-------------------+------------------------------------------------+
"""
article_title = TextField(default='')
journal = ForeignKeyField(Journals, backref='citations')
journal_volume = IntegerField(default=-1)
journal_issue = IntegerField(default=-1)
page_range = CharField(default='')
abstract_text = TextField(default='')
xml_text = TextField(default='')
release_authorization_id = CharField(default='')
doi_reference = CharField(default='')
encoding = CharField(default='UTF8')
